40. 40Transactional Execution (a/k/a Transactional Memory)
Software-defined sequence treated by hardware as atomic transaction
Enables significantly more efficient software Highly-parallelized
applications Speculative code generation Lock elision Designed for
exploitation by Java; longer-term opportunity for DB2, z/OS,
othersRuntime instrumentation Real-time information to software on
dynamic program characteristics Enables increased optimization in
JVM/JIT recompilations Additional exploitation opportunities in the
works2 GB page frames Increased efficiency for DB2 buffer pools,
Java heap, other large structuresSoftware directives to improve
hardware performance Data usage intent improves cache management
Branch pre-load improves branch prediction effectiveness Block
prefetch moves data closer to processor earlier, reducing access
latencyDecimal format conversions Enable broader exploitation of
Decimal Floating Point facility by COBOL programszEC12 Architecture
Extensions

48. 48Time to ReadData measuredin System zInstructionsExternal
Disk(4K page)~5,000KInstructionsFlash Memory(4K
page)~100KInstructionsReal Memory:(256B line)~100
InstructionsMoreLatency Flash Express is intended to improve System
z availability Slash latency delays from paging Flash Memory is
much faster than spinning disk Flash Memory is much slower than
main memory Flash Memory takes less power than either Make your
start of day processing fast Designed to eliminate delays from SVC
Dump processing zEC12 offers optional Flash Express memory cards
Supported in PCIe I/O drawer with other PCIe I/O cards Installed in
pairs for availability No HCD/IOCP definitions required Assign
Flash Memory to partitions like main memory Assignment is by memory
amount, not by feature Each partitions Flash Memory is isolated
like main memory Dynamically increase the partition maximum amount
of Flash Dynamically configure Flash Memory into and out of the
partitionIntroducing Flash Express

51. 51IBM zAware delivers smarter message
monitoringcapabilitiesThe complexity and rate of change of todays
IT infrastructures stress the limitsof IT to resolve problems
quickly and accuratelywhile preserving SLAsIT is challenged to
diagnose system anomalies and restore service quickly Systems often
experience problems which are difficult or unusual to detect
Existing tools do little to quickly identify messages preceding
system problems Some incidents begin with symptoms that remain
undetected for long periods oftime Manual log analysis is
skills-intensive, and prone to errorsIBM zAware with Expert System
Diagnostics Gets it Right, Fast IBM zAware helps improve problem
determination in near real time helpsrapidly and accurately
identify problems and speed time to recovery Analyzes massive
amounts of data to identify problematic messages,
providinginformation to enable faster corrective action Analytics
on log data provides a near real time view of current system state
Cutting edge pattern recognition examines system behavior to help
you pinpointdeviations Machine learning, modeling and historical
data work to describe your uniqueenvironment
